From be1daa3d01194b8ca15a536f1a813efdcb5e04bb Mon Sep 17 00:00:00 2001 From: ulfvonbelow Date: Fri, 3 May 2024 14:13:23 -0500 Subject: [PATCH] util: ensure nonzero stack allocation in G_C_symmetric_encrypt. --- src/lib/util/crypto_symmetric.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/lib/util/crypto_symmetric.c b/src/lib/util/crypto_symmetric.c index a9217febd..c08b84c17 100644 --- a/src/lib/util/crypto_symmetric.c +++ b/src/lib/util/crypto_symmetric.c @@ -137,7 +137,7 @@ GNUNET_CRYPTO_symmetric_encrypt (const void *block, void *result) { gcry_cipher_hd_t handle; - char tmp[size]; + char tmp[GNUNET_NZL(size)]; if (GNUNET_OK != setup_cipher_aes (&handle, sessionkey, iv)) return -1; -- 2.41.0